Duties:
- Greeting clients, visitors, and staff with a professional and courteous demeanour and managing check-ins with efficiency.
- Managing a multi-line phone system to answer and redirect calls promptly while maintaining professionalism.
- Coordinating conference room bookings and ensuring meeting spaces are prepared and well-equipped for use.
- Handling mail and deliveries, including sorting, distributing, and scheduling courier pickups as needed.
- Maintaining a clean and organized reception area that reflects the company's commitment to high standards.
- Assisting with administrative tasks such as filing, data entry, and preparing documents or reports for meetings.
- Adhering to security protocols by managing visitor logs, issuing access badges, and monitoring building entry procedures.
